The third instalment in the apocalyptic horror A Quiet Place franchise, directed by Michael Sarnoski and based on a story co-written by series creator John Krasinski, this spin-off prequel stars Lupita Nyong'o, Joseph Quinn, and Alex Wolff, with Djimon Hounsou reprising his role from Part II.
Taking place before the first film, it sees New Yorker Sam (Nyong'o) fight to survive when bloodthirsty alien creatures with ultrasonic hearing launch a truly terrifying invasion on Earth.
